Over 11.81 million COVID vaccine jabs administered in Azerbaijan

Some 22,586 people received their anti-coronavirus shots in Azerbaijan today, the Task Force under the Cabinet of Ministers told Report.
The number of those who got their first jab reached 2,042 people today, while 2,122 people got their second dose of the vaccine. As many as 18,422 people got immunized with the third (booster) dose of a COVID vaccine.
To date, 11,813,840 coronavirus vaccine jabs have been administered to the population in Azerbaijan. Of this, 5,214,124 citizens have received their first shot only, while 4,729,272 got both doses.
As of today, 1,870,444 people have received a booster dose of coronavirus vaccines in Azerbaijan.
